Transaction ff54d4cdcfd17a0080ce3657425760bb8bd2277558fe58103b140aff0a3e4350

1 Input
1 Outputs
  • ff54d4cdcfd17a0080ce3657425760bb8bd2277558fe58103b140aff0a3e4350:0
  • value  111309
    address  1DFBBbKtmvaUpkw1KWowtjef1kAbsaQRg4